Where can i get a hiv test - There are three types of HIV tests: antibody tests, antigen/antibody tests, and nucleic acid tests (NAT). Antibody tests look for antibodies to HIV in a person’s blood or oral fluid. Antibody tests can take 23 to 90 days to detect HIV after exposure. Most rapid tests and the only FDA-approved HIV self-test are antibody tests.

Note: State laws regarding self-testing vary and may limit availability. Check with a health …You can get an HIV test at many places: Your health care provider’s office. Health clinics or community health centers. STD or sexual health clinics. Your local health department. Family planning clinics. VA medical centers. Substance abuse prevention or treatment programs. A rapid HIV test can test for HIV and return the results in a short period of time, usually 20 minutes. There are two kinds of rapid HIV tests: A rapid self-test can be taken in a private location, while a rapid point-of-care test is given at a clinic or healthcare provider's office. Anonymous testing means only you will know the HIV test result. When you take an anonymous HIV test, you get a unique identifier that allows you to get your test results. You can also buy an HIV self-test if you want to test anonymously. But with proper medical care, HIV can be controlled.Tests always produce a small number of false positive results. In settings where very few people have HIV, a higher proportion of reactive results will be false positives. HIV (human immunodeficiency virus) and AIDS (acq... A false negative is a test result that says a person does not have HIV when, in fact, they do. False negative results most often occur when people test in the first few weeks after infection, during the ‘window period’ of a test. At this time, the markers of infection (p24 antigen and antibodies) that tests look for may be absent or scarce.
